The 2020 sexual harassment scandal at Gomal University in Dera Ismail Khan serves as a stark case study of the systemic vulnerabilities and power imbalances within academic institutions. Central to this scandal was Professor Hafiz Salahuddin (the primary figure often associated with " Professor Rashid
" in public discourse), a high-ranking academic who headed multiple departments, including the Institute of Linguistics and Humanities and Islamic Studies. The Sting Operation and Video Evidence
The scandal gained nationwide attention following a media sting operation that reportedly captured the professor engaging in indecent and immoral behavior with a female student.
The Evidence: The audio-visual recordings were reviewed by university administration and reportedly showed the professor attempting to harass a student who had approached him as part of the undercover investigation.
The Admission: When confronted with the video evidence, the university administration stated that the professor acknowledged his guilt.
Immediate Fallout: Following the review of these "indecent and immoral" videos, Vice-Chancellor Chaudhry Mohammad Sarwar forced the professor to resign in February 2020. Broader Institutional Context
The "Professor Rashid" case was not an isolated incident but rather a symptom of a larger culture of misconduct at the university.
Widespread Misconduct: At the time of the scandal, the university was probing 12 separate cases of harassment involving various faculty members. This led to the dismissal of several other employees, including Professors Bakhtiar Khattak and Imran Qureshi.
Multi-Layered Issues: Beyond harassment, an inquiry committee found evidence of other systemic failures at Gomal University, including the issuance of fake degrees and the open sale of drugs on campus. Impact on Campus Safety and Policy
The scandal sparked significant outrage among student activist groups, such as the Progressive Students Collective, who argued that educational institutions had failed to provide a secure environment. The incident highlighted a critical lack of:
Functional Harassment Committees: There was a noted absence of committees with proper student representation.
Visible Code of Conduct: Reports indicated that official codes of conduct regarding harassment were not clearly displayed or enforced.
Accountability: Critics pointed out that while the professor was forced to resign, he should have been terminated immediately to set a stronger precedent against moral turpitude.
The Gomal University scandal remains a landmark case in Pakistan's academic history, eventually contributing to stronger demands for legislation to protect students from sexual harassment on campuses. Bill protecting students from sexual harassment backed

The 2020 harassment scandal at Gomal University in Dera Ismail Khan serves as a critical case study on the intersection of academic authority, gender-based violence, and the role of digital evidence in pursuing justice. The controversy primarily involved Professor Hafiz Salahuddin
, the then-Director of the Institute of Linguistics and Humanities and Dean of Arts, who was forced to resign following the leak of a video documenting his misconduct. The Incident and Evidence
The scandal came to light when a video surfaced showing the professor harassing a female student. Reports indicated that the footage was captured during a sting operation after the student approached him regarding an academic or administrative matter. In the video, the professor is seen making inappropriate advances, which led to a public outcry and rapid dissemination across social media platforms like Facebook and Dailymotion. Institutional Response
Following the circulation of the video, the university administration took immediate action:
Forced Resignation: The Vice-Chancellor accepted the resignation of Prof. Hafiz Salahuddin on February 25, 2020, under the Gomal University Pension Statutes.
Disassociation: The university issued a formal statement clarifying that it was not responsible for the professor's "moral turpitude" and aimed to make the case an example for others.
Broader Investigation: An inquiry committee later found that issues at the university extended beyond harassment, including reports of fake degrees and drug sales on campus. Social and Ethical Implications
The scandal highlighted the systemic failure of educational institutions to provide a secure environment for students. Student activist groups, such as the Progressive Students Collective, used the incident to demand the establishment of campus harassment committees with student representation. The case remains a prominent example of how digital "video evidence" can act as a catalyst for institutional accountability in environments where power imbalances often silence victims.
